Seasonal Playbook

Growing season brings vigorous growth that benefits from form pruning and disease inspections. Summer in Paloma Creek, TX can strain canopies; hydration plans and light balancing keep roots protected. Pre-winter is ideal for deadwood cuts, cabling checks, and storm readiness. Cool season allows larger structural work with less sap flow and leaf-free sightlines.

Scheduling work with seasonal cycles, we lower stress on trees, boost healing, and secure long-lasting results.

Paloma Creek is a master-planned community in northeastern Denton County, Texas, United States. The community is listed by the U.S. Census Bureau as two separate census-designated places, "Paloma Creek" and "Paloma Creek South", separated by U.S. Highway 380. As of the 2010 census, the Paloma Creek CDP (known locally as "Paloma Creek North") had a population of 2,501, while Paloma Creek South had a population of 2,753. As of 2022, the HOA currently estimates the population to be approximately 20,000.
